A primary disadvantage to the practice of riverboat gambling is their monumental costs, which offsetted any promises Sander made to begin with. Recall that Sander planned for each individual riverboat to contribute five million dollars to environmental aid, meaning that even if all eleven Fox River riverboats extant in the present day contributed Sander’s given amount, only fiftyfive million dollars would be allotted. This measly sum is easily squandered by costs historically needed in the construction of riverboat casinos themselves. The aforementioned project of expanding the City of Lights I by 238 feet required twenty million dollars alone, a hefty price that would greatly increase when considering the price for building the riverboat in the first place.19 What’s more, significant funds are spent on decor: over the six months preceding the expansion, 1.5 million dollars were wasted on constructing Hollywood-themed artifacts to be placed within the boat.20 In a more extreme case, the riverfront pavilion complex from which the Hollywood CasinoAurora departed, home to complementary Hollywood and Las Vegas-themed entertainment, necessitated an entire seventy-five million dollars during its construction.21 In short, while Sander claims riverboat casinos would result in a net profit for the environment, a considerably more markable contribution could be made by simply reallocating the funds originally used for riverboat casinos into environmental agencies.
